Expert Biohazard Removal

Biohazardous materials, including blood, bodily fluids, feces, and other biological matter, pose severe health risks due to the potential presence of blood-borne pathogens such as HIV, Hepatitis B & C, and MRSA. Standard cleaning methods and household products are not sufficient to effectively safely decontaminate these environments.

Our specialized technicians are trained to safely isolate the affected area, completely remove all biohazardous materials, and employ extensive sanitization and deodorization processes using hospital-grade chemicals. Our Process

  1. Assessment & Containment: We assess the scene to identify all affected areas and establish isolation zones to prevent cross-contamination.
  2. Safe Removal: All biohazardous materials and irrecoverable items are safely removed and disposed of according to EPA and state regulations.
  3. Decontamination: We apply specialized, deeply penetrating sterilization chemicals across all affected surfaces to eliminate microscopic pathogens.
  4. Deodorization & Testing: Advanced odor removal technology (such as hydroxyl generators) is utilized, followed by ATP testing to guarantee a completely safe environment.
